Catalog description

We all know something about the 1960s?Vietnam, hippies, the Summer of Love, Nixon. But the social, cultural, and political conflicts and developments of that decade are at the root of many of today?s controversies about how America is changing and whether those changes are for the better. In this class we will learn about the major events of the 1960s, see 1960s movies, read 1960s literature, and listen to 1960s music. By doing so, we will come to a greater understanding of what was happening in the 1960s, and how that influences American society today.
